删除数据库中自定义的wp_postmeta或者其他在post_meta的数据表

许多Wordpress的主题都有用到自定义域, 自定义域使用的范围很多, 可以用来添加略缩图, 自定义keyword(关键词), description(描述)等等.

但是当换上另一款主题时, 在每一篇文章中的自定义域添加的内容就成了多余的数据库垃圾了. 如果文章数量手动每条删除的方法不现实.

我们可以在执行一个SQL语句来批量删除特定的数据表, 自定义域添加的数据表也是有共同的名称, 所以可以同时用命令删除.

主要的输入的命令为


delete from wp_postmeta where meta_key = "自定义域的名称";

如果自定义域添加的名称为"keywords", 命令为:


delete from wp_postmeta where meta_key = "keywords";

其他的类似, EI测试命令删除得很彻底, 不会危及其他数据表的资料, 但是EI建议不熟悉数据库的话还是备份一下数据库再继续操作.

在自定义域的下拉列表中没有了想要删除的那个选项就证明删除成功了.

作者: EI

链接: 删除数据库中自定义的wp_postmeta或者其他在post_meta的数据表

本站所有文章,除特别标明外, 皆为原创. 如需转载, 请复制粘贴下面的代码到文章底部.

转载自 <a href="http://www.ei2u.com/wordpress/work/512.html" title="删除数据库中自定义的wp_postmeta或者其他在post_meta的数据表" rel="bookmark">删除数据库中自定义的wp_postmeta或者其他在post_meta的数据表 | e网软摘</a>